Fest (Ger.) – Fiato (It.)

Fest (Ger.)

Festival.

Fest (Ger.)

Fast; fixed.

Fester Gesang

Canto firmo.

Festgesang

Festival song.

Festivo (It.) (fes-tee'-vo)

Festive; solemn.

Feuer (Ger.) (foy-ehr)

Fire.

Feuerig (Ger.)

Fiery.

Fiacco (It.) (fee-ak'-ko)

Weak; faint.

Fiasco (It.)

A failure; breakdown. Literally, " a flask."

Fiato (It.)

Breath.
